glenn0010 wrote: ↑Feb 23 2018 2:21pm
Buk___ wrote: ↑Feb 23 2018 1:32pm
12 magnets, 6 pole pairs, 18 teeth.
So the pole pairs is the number of magnets/2?
(Mostly*)Yes.
(*It is possible to use multiple magnets side-by-side oriented the same way to create a single pole -- act a single magnet -- but you will rarely ever encounter that in a commercial motor.)
